Lockstitch Tension Specifications
Proper lockstitch tension is critical in manufacturing pajamas for men bamboo. The tension settings will directly impact the seam appearance, material integrity, and production efficiency. For bamboo-derived fabrics, upper thread tension should range between 90-120 cN, while bobbin tension should maintain a range from 20-25 cN. Thread tension needs real-time adjustments based on research on the stretch percentage of bamboo knits (typically 5-8%) and the stitch density you’re targeting. A plain stitch setup of 10-12 SPI (stitches per inch) minimizes flagging issues and balances durability with material flexibility.

Use polyester corespun threads (ticket 60/3) for pajamas for men bamboo, as these handle thread breakage better on semi-automatic JUKI DDL 9000C series machines. Always conduct pre-production lockstitch tension tests based on AQL 2.5 standards to avoid batch rejection. This QA step detects stitch bubbling or skipped stitches caused by machine imbalances or tension anomalies.
Seam Strength in Bamboo Fabrics
Seam strength is non-negotiable in pajamas for men bamboo, particularly for high-stress areas like the crotch seam, shoulder join, and elastic waistband attachment. Bamboo fabrics exhibit elongation properties that demand reinforced stitching in key zones. Use a flatlock setup with four threads and needle gauge compatibilities like DPx5, which minimize seam puckering.
ASTM D5035 tensile strength testing is mandatory before scaling OEM batches to ensure compliance. Seams should withstand 25N in warp direction and a minimum of 12N in the weft for satisfactory tear resistance. If tensile strength falls below these thresholds, evaluate improper thread tension, blunt needles, or incompatible feed settings. Remember, seamless knitting is an option for invisible seams in premium ranges of pajamas for men bamboo; however, tooling on circular knitting machines like Santoni SM8 series can inflate CMT prices by at least 15-20%, impacting markup margins if not properly forecasted.
OEM Scaling and Tier-1 Sourcing
Scaling OEM production for pajamas for men bamboo is heavily reliant on a robust tier-1 sourcing network and the ability to standardize inputs across SKUs. Bamboo yarns should be sourced from suppliers who meet OEKO-TEX 100 certification standards, ensuring product safety and reduced batch yield discrepancies. Failure to secure consistent bamboo yarn batches, especially with incorrect denier grades, causes shrinkage deviations that lead to size chart-related markdown losses.
Maintain a lean QC process at the first point of yarn delivery by auditing spool weight consistency and colorfastness metrics through ISO 105-C06 protocols. Dyeing processes for pajamas for men bamboo present unique challenges due to bamboo fibers’ semi-open cell structure. Factory-level dyebaths in reactive dye processes require precise salt concentrations and a controlled pH range of 11.0-11.5 to avoid color bleeding post-wash.
Automation for Consistency
To address scaling needs in pajamas for men bamboo, automation tools like auto-thread trimmers (installed in all JUKI lockstitch or overlock machines) can improve production rates by 12-15%. Conveyor-driven staging tables for pre-assembly processes ensure consistent fabric placement without manual misalignments, reducing production rejects by up to 10%. AI-enabled defect inspectors, such as cameras with fabric flaw detection, should be integrated to maintain consistent AQL results.
Robotics may be cost-intensive at the setup phase, but OEM manufacturers need to calculate long-term ROI. Automating repetitive tasks like elastic waistband attachment will reduce manual operator fatigue and save at least 4 seconds per unit. On a 10K daily output of pajamas for men bamboo, this equals over 11 productive hours per shift cycle.
Tech Pack Preparation and Yield Optimization
An accurate tech pack is the blueprint for producing cost-effective, high-quality OEM batches of pajamas for men bamboo. Bamboo fabrics are highly absorbent; cutting allowances of an additional 1-2% are essential to mitigate losses from heat shrinkage in post-production washing. Include detailed grading rules for all sizes in the tech pack, specifying tolerance limits (e.g., +/- 0.5 cm) to prevent discrepancies in batch approvals during first-fit assessments.
While focusing on yield maximization, always adopt markers capable of utilizing 86%+ of fabric width. Laser cutters allow for better accuracy, especially with low-gauge bamboo blends prone to rolling edges. A mere 2% improvement in yield can boost gross profit margins by several percentage points, making cutting efficiency an essential metric to monitor.

Packaging Efficiency and Logistics
Packaging for pajamas for men bamboo should prioritize compressed flat-fold techniques using minimalistic eco-friendly materials. Vacuum-seal technology can decrease carton sizes by up to 50%, optimizing container space for overseas shipping. Including a recycled paper belly band around the pajamas’ fold adds eco-certified value—a growing demand among sustainability-conscious buyers.
For export logistics involving pajamas for men bamboo Supply Chain Solutions, palletizing based on SKU segmentation ensures smooth customs clearance. Ensure compliance with ISPM-15 regulations by using heat-treated wood pallets for international shipments. Consolidated shipping options through 3PL partners are critical for cost reductions, particularly when targeting markets in North America and the EU, which involve diverse retail channels.
